White Blossom Sweet Clover

Melilotus alba

White Blossom Sweet Clover is an introduced clover from Europe but is not found in much of the United States. This biennial legume is an important and highly valued specie used in many aspects of agriculture, honey production and soil stabilization and improvement.

Typically blooms 2-4 weeks later than Yellow Blossom
Fast establishing and rapid regrowth
Good nitrogen fixing legume
Excellent food source for pollinators
Valued for honey production
Very good soil building capabilities and soil stabilization
Good forage quality
Mature height of 3-4 FT
